What is an escrow officer assistant?

Escrow Officer Assistants are professionals who support escrow officers in managing real estate transactions. They handle administrative tasks such as preparing documents, coordinating with buyers, sellers, and lenders, and ensuring all required paperwork is complete and accurate. Their role is vital in maintaining smooth communication between all parties and helping the escrow process proceed efficiently. Escrow Officer Assistants often work in title companies, law firms, or real estate offices, and they play a key part in ensuring timely closings.

What are the most common challenges faced by escrow officer assistants, and how can they be addressed?

Escrow Officer Assistants often juggle multiple transactions simultaneously, which can make time management and attention to detail challenging. Staying organized by using checklists and digital tracking tools is essential to ensure deadlines are met and paperwork is accurate. Additionally, effective communication with all parties—clients, lenders, realtors, and escrow officers—is crucial to keep transactions on track and resolve issues quickly. Proactively seeking clarification and ongoing training can help new assistants adapt to the fast-paced environment and complex regulations in the escrow industry.

What is the difference between Escrow Officer Assistant vs Escrow Officer?

AspectEscrow Officer AssistantEscrow Officer
CredentialsTypically requires high school diploma or equivalent; some may have real estate or escrow certificationsRequires real estate or escrow licensing, certifications, and experience
Work EnvironmentSupports escrow officers in an office setting, handling administrative tasksManages escrow transactions directly, interacts with clients, lenders, and title companies
Employer & IndustryReal estate agencies, title companies, escrow firmsTitle companies, real estate firms, banks

The main difference is that the Escrow Officer Assistant provides administrative support and assists escrow officers, while the Escrow Officer manages the entire escrow process, interacts directly with clients, and holds more responsibility for transaction completion.

About the position

The Escrow Officer is responsible for managing escrow files from the date of receipt through the date of completion. This involves the administration of construction escrow accounts and basic commercial and residential accounts. When needed, assist in preparing more complex escrow transactions. This position is responsible for curative matters and title exceptions to be cleared and may have the authority to waive exceptions. Smooth and efficient closings are essential since this position is responsible for conducting all stages of the transaction to the satisfaction of all parties involved. Pre- and post-closing tasks require extensive phone and personal contact.

Job Duties Include:

  • Meets with attorneys, realtors, lenders, and customers to review and/or draft the escrow instructions and agreements for residential and basic commercial closings. Facilitates the objectives of the parties in closing the escrow.
  • Checks title commitments and tax certificates for accuracy, outstanding liens, exceptions, or any other title problems that may be cleared prior to closing.
  • Sets up accurate escrow files, including the initial filing, deposits, and all relevant documents.
  • Prepares for closing by requesting pay-off statements and figuring loans, lien releases, insurance and legal records, and/or necessary documents to ensure that lender instructions coincide with the purchase agreement.
  • Conducts the execution of closing documents on and off the company’s premises and approves the finalized closing statements. Communicates and sends lender packages according to closing instructions. Disburse funds in accordance with standard accounting procedures and customer and lender requirements.
  • Manages and administers trust accounts.
  • Addresses questions and concerns from realtors, attorneys, buyers, and sellers in regard to insurance, taxes, title work, foreclosures, and legal documents.
  • Inputs, accesses, and retrieves data relevant to closings. Reviews, executes, and distributes finalized policies and closings.
